Nice work on the `keyspin` rotation utility overall, but the retry constants shouldn't be scattered through `rotate.py` — support will need to adjust these during incidents without hunting. Please consolidate them into one module with comments explaining each. For reference when reviewing, the values we agreed on with the Delverton team are these.

tuning constants:
QUOTAS = {
    "druwyn": 5,
    "holix": 5,
    "zorath": 5,
    "holwyn": 10,
}

**Q: Why did my plugin's driver get reassigned mid-route?**

Short answer: the Hoplane dispatcher re-runs its driver-assignment heuristic every few minutes, and a closer or less-loaded driver can win the job. Plugins shouldn't cache assignments for more than one cycle. If your plugin needs to pin an assignment, request a lock through the sandbox console. Unlocking the sandbox for the first time requires the recovery passphrase shown below.

unlock words, kagef-taduf: fenir-quenix-norwyn-sorvan-gormir-gorir-fraok

Runbook: Verdara Greenhouse Controller — Sensor Drift. If humidity readings from the canopy array diverge by more than 4% from the reference probe, the Verdara node begins auto-recalibration, which can mask real failures. First, pause the recalibration loop via the ops console, then run the drift-audit script against bay 3. The script reads its calibration API credential from your environment file, set on the following line.

vault entry, yahif-yajep: COURIER_KEY29=b802bdf8034096b65a51c6ba5abe2

## Runbook: Fennel shipping-fee rules engine

Fee disputes: check the rule trace first, not the order record. Rules reload every five minutes; a stale ruleset is the usual cause of mismatched fees. Force-reload via the admin endpoint if the trace shows an old version. The engine runs with the following configuration values:

service settings:
[casax]
port = 6379
team = rusir
host = casax.zemvarhq.corp
region = outer-4
access_code = ac_9808ce
timeout_ms = 1500